ENGLISH Basic Operation TONE CONTROL SELECT CH SELECT CURSOR F CURSOR G TONE DEFEAT Tone control setting 2 Adjusting the sound quality (tone) The tone control function will not work in the PURE DIRECT or DIRECT mode. 1 Press the TONE CONTROL button. The tone switches as follows each time the TONE CONTROL button is pressed. BASS TREBLE 2 Turn the SELECT knob to adjust the level of the bass or treble. To increase the bass or treble: Turn the control clockwise. (The bass or treble sound can be increased up to +6 dB in steps of 1 dB.) To decrease the bass or treble: Turn the control counterclockwise. (The bass or treble sound can be decreased down to -6 dB in steps of 1 dB.) 2 Tone defeat mode If you do not want the bass and treble to be adjusted, turn on the tone defeat mode. Press the TONE DEFEAT button. Channel Level You can adjust the channel level either according to the playback sources or to suit your taste, as described below. 1 Press the CH SELECT button to select the speaker whose level you want to adjust. The channel switches as shown below each time the button is pressed. FL C FR SR SW SL SBL SBR When the surround back speaker setting is set to "1sp" for "Speaker Configuration", this is set to "SB". "SB" appears only when the "Power Amp Assign." setting is the surround back mode. 2 Press the CURSOR F or G button to adjust the level of the selected speaker. The default setting of the channel level is 0 dB. The level of the selected speaker can be adjusted within the range of +12 to -12 dB by pressing the CURSOR buttons. The SW channel level can be turned off by decreasing it one step from -12 dB.
